At IBERDROLA, we consider working in cultural diversity to be essential. Thus, we have taken initiatives with a view to raising employee awareness on functional diversity, in such projects as “Awareness by and for equality and diversity”.
In order to enforce the non-discrimination principle, the V Collective Agreement specifies that employees with diminished capacities to perform their job duties as a result of medical reasons, and who have not obtained a declaration of permanent disability, shall be reassigned to a post more suitable to their aptitudes and knowledge, yet conserving their original category.
With a view to assisting employees who have family members with some sort of disability, there is the Family Plan, whose objective lies in helping these family members integrate into the labour and social world.
